摘要
Abstract Typical commercial application of WAO on sludge treatment is first used in China, system design and debugging, and effect and cost performance is illustrated in this article. It reduces the temperature and pressure of a typical wet oxidation reaction, and the oxygen supplied is only 30- 50 % of the COD, which is specifically used to treat sludge. After the treatment, the sludge moisture content from 80 % to 45-48 %, and become harmless and stabilized, so it can be used as soil for gardens directly or mixed with other materials. As a supplementary carbon source for the nitrogen removal and phosphorus removal process, the separation solution is rich in organic acids and returned to the sewage plant after the heavy metal removal process. The operating cost of the entire process is 180-200 yuan per ton (80 % moisture content), mainly for electricity consumption.
